The National Public Telecomputing Network says that starting a Free-Net has never been successfully done by a single person and that it always requires a group of several people to successfully get started. We beg to differ. For those of you who don't already know, Clif Cox started the original EFN service in a small closet under the stairs in his home. It grew there to 22 phone lines. Since the Eugene Free Community Network and Lane Online joined forces last year, many of us have been wondering if or how we could ever repay Clif for his $35,000 of equipment, software and sweat equity he invested to get the original EFN system up and running. In December, Clif sold all the original equipment to OPN for $1 and donated the remaining $34,999 on the condition that OPN continue to keep the current free services free. It was an outstanding and inspiring individual contribution to the whole greater Eugene-Springfield area.
